Beyond household meals, Lablab can be processed into a variety of products that contribute to the broader economy. It serves as excellent animal feed, providing nutrition for livestock, while also being transformed into valuable bioproducts like starch and oil. The capacity for local farmers to tap into this extensive value chain means they can diversify their income and contribute significantly to food security in Mauritius.

That break-even figure is the one that surprises most farmers the most. Many smallholder farmers sell their harvest without this number and as a result find themselves negotiating without a clear bottom line. Once you know your break-even point you know the minimum price you can accept and the minimum quantity you need to sell. That knowledge alone changes everything about how you approach the market.

Practical Tips for Lablab (Hyacinth Bean) Farmers in Mauritius

1. Prioritize Soil Health: Healthy soil is the foundation of successful Lablab farming. Regularly adding organic matter, such as compost, can dramatically improve soil fertility and structure. Farmers who focus on soil health often see better crop resilience and higher yields over time.

2. Rotate Crops Wisely: Practicing crop rotation with Lablab can break pest cycles and improve soil nutrients. If you rely solely on one crop, the risks of pests and soil depletion increase. Farmers who embrace diversity in their fields typically enjoy stronger harvests and reduced losses.

3. Create a Schedule for Irrigation: Whether through rain collection or irrigation, a consistent watering schedule is essential. Many farmers who wait for rainfall alone may face crop stress during drier periods. Scheduling your irrigation can ensure that plants receive adequate moisture for optimal growth.

4. Engage in Community Learning: Sharing knowledge with fellow farmers can lead to innovative solutions to common challenges. Those who participate in farmer groups or cooperatives often have access to resources and support networks that enhance their farming practices. This collaboration can improve the financial outcomes for all involved.

5. Monitor Market Trends Regularly: Understanding market demands helps determine the best time to sell your Lablab. Farmers who stay informed on market trends can identify the right moments to sell, resulting in better prices and reduced losses. Regular awareness of the market can lead to smarter, more profitable planting choices.

1. What is Lablab (Hyacinth Bean) and how is it grown?

Lablab is a versatile legume that thrives in tropical climates. It is typically grown from seeds in well-drained soil and requires ample sunlight along with the right balance of water to reach its full potential.

2. What are the main benefits of growing Lablab in Mauritius?

Growing Lablab provides numerous benefits including increased food security and nutritional value for families. Additionally, it offers a source of income and employment opportunities in local communities.

3. How can I improve the yield of my Lablab crop?

Improving yield starts with proper soil management and effective pest control. Regular monitoring and timely interventions can substantially increase both quality and quantity of your harvest.

4. What are the common pests and diseases affecting Lablab?

Common pests include aphids and caterpillars, while diseases might involve root rot or blight. Early detection and sustainable management techniques are essential to protect your crops.
